The cost is $20/half day/lounger, $40/day/lounger and if you book the entire cruise, $30/day/lounger.

 

You book "your" lounger, i.e., you select the specific lounger and location (in the sun, in partial shade, facing the water, etc.) and that's your lounger for the duration you've booked. No one else can use that lounger and you can come and go as you please.

 

The loungers are large and very comfortable. Attendants bring you pillows, towels, blankets (as needed), iced towels, ice water, etc. You can order food ($3 delivery charge) and drinks (at regular prices) and the attendants will bring them to your lounger.

 

Afternoon tea is served at about 3:30pm every day with a selection of sandwiches, pastries, cookies, scones, jelly and tea.

 

Other than on the Coral, there is no pool in the Sanctuary although there is one nearby on all ships.

 

The Sanctuary isn't for everyone but I love it and book it on cruises with a lot of sea days. I no longer get balcony cabins but instead book oceanview or inside cabins and splurge on the Sanctuary.
